Quality monitoring
The National Iranian Oil Products Distribution Company (NIOPD) is responsible for the supply and distribution of fuels, including liquid fuels and compressed natural gas, across the country. Thus, the NIOPD is also responsible for ensuring that the fuels it delivers meet the country specifications.
However, Iran’s fuel quality monitoring scheme is unclear, and the government currently does not enforce the specifications to be met by refiners.
In summer 2017, the Tehran Air Quality Control Company, a subsidiary of the Tehran Municipality, conducted fuel quality assessments and collected samples of gasoline and diesel from random fuel stations across Tehran. However, the results were not made public.
